💖 How to Keep the Spark Alive in a Long-Term Relationship

Long-term relationships can face challenges, especially as the years go by. Life gets busy, and sometimes the initial spark of excitement can fade. However, keeping the passion and connection alive is not impossible. With intentional effort and mindfulness, you can maintain a thriving, loving relationship.

Here are some tips on how to keep the spark alive and nurture a strong bond:


1. Prioritize Quality Time Together

In the hustle and bustle of everyday life, it’s easy for couples to lose track of spending quality time together. Whether it’s work, kids, or other responsibilities, it can feel like there’s never enough time for your relationship. However, making time for each other is essential for keeping the spark alive.

Tip: Schedule regular date nights, even if it’s just watching a movie together at home. The goal is to focus on each other and enjoy each other’s company.


2. Communicate Openly and Honestly

Clear, open communication is crucial in every relationship, but it’s especially important in long-term ones. Over time, misunderstandings can creep in if you aren’t actively communicating your thoughts and feelings. Express your emotions, desires, and concerns to ensure you’re both on the same page.

Tip: Don’t let issues build up. Have regular “check-ins” with your partner to discuss how you’re feeling and address any concerns before they escalate.


3. Keep the Physical Connection Strong

Physical intimacy is a vital part of a romantic relationship. Over time, it’s easy for physical touch to decrease, but maintaining intimacy is essential for emotional bonding. This doesn’t just mean sex — it can be simple gestures like holding hands, hugging, and kissing.

Tip: Don’t underestimate the power of a simple touch. A kiss in the morning or holding hands while walking can help foster closeness.


4. Be Playful and Spontaneous

A long-term relationship doesn’t have to be all serious business. A little playfulness can go a long way in rekindling the spark between you and your partner. Try new activities, plan surprises, or just have fun together without worrying about the stresses of life.

Tip: Be spontaneous by planning a surprise weekend getaway, or try something new like taking a dance class together or playing games.


5. Show Appreciation and Affection

Over time, it’s easy to take each other for granted. However, expressing appreciation for your partner is a simple yet powerful way to maintain a loving and fulfilling relationship. Whether it’s a compliment, a note of gratitude, or simply telling them you love them, showing affection regularly helps maintain the emotional bond.

Tip: Make it a habit to say “thank you” for the small things your partner does. Everyone likes to feel appreciated.


6. Support Each Other’s Growth

In a long-term relationship, you and your partner will grow and change. It’s important to support each other’s personal growth and interests. When both partners feel like they can continue to grow as individuals, the relationship can grow stronger too.

Tip: Encourage your partner to pursue their passions, hobbies, and career goals. When both partners thrive individually, it creates a stronger bond in the relationship.


7. Don’t Let Conflict Escalate

No relationship is without conflict, but how you handle disagreements can make or break your relationship. In long-term relationships, unresolved issues can accumulate, which can erode the emotional connection. Instead of letting arguments escalate, focus on resolving them constructively.

Tip: When you argue, try to focus on the issue at hand, not past mistakes. Listen to your partner’s point of view and work together to find a solution.


8. Travel Together

There’s nothing like getting away from the everyday routine to recharge your relationship. Traveling together creates new shared experiences and memories, which can reignite the excitement and adventure in your relationship.

Tip: Plan a trip, whether it’s a weekend getaway or a long vacation. Exploring new places together helps you rediscover each other and keeps things exciting.


9. Keep a Sense of Humor

Laughter is an important part of any lasting relationship. Life will throw curveballs, and you may face challenges, but being able to laugh together can help you both cope with difficult situations. A sense of humor can break the tension and keep things light-hearted.

Tip: Don’t take life too seriously. Share jokes, watch comedy shows, or laugh over silly things that happen during your day.


10. Be Understanding During Tough Times

Every relationship will face difficult times. Whether it’s financial stress, personal struggles, or health challenges, how you support each other during these moments can strengthen your bond. Being patient, understanding, and compassionate during tough times will help you both navigate challenges together.

Tip: Remember that you’re a team. Lean on each other for support, and be patient with your partner during difficult times. It’s the hard times that often bring couples closer together.
